LoRa
LoRa (Long Range) is a wireless communication technology designed for long-range, low-power, and low-data-rate applications, making it ideal for Internet of Things (IoT) solutions. It operates in sub-gigahertz frequency bands, such as 433 MHz, 868 MHz, and 915 MHz, depending on regional regulations. LoRa employs a unique modulation technique called Chirp Spread Spectrum (CSS), which enables robust signal transmission over extended distances while maintaining strong penetration through obstacles like buildings. This technology is particularly well-suited for applications such as smart metering, environmental monitoring, asset tracking, smart agriculture, and smart city solutions, where devices need to transmit small amounts of data over long distances with minimal energy consumption. Additionally, LoRa supports bidirectional communication and incorporates advanced encryption for enhanced security, making it a scalable and reliable choice for efficient IoT connectivity.
LoRaWAN
The LoRaWAN® radio system from welle digital enables data to be transmitted over long distances in a cost-effective and efficient manner.
LoRaWAN® is an international, open radio standard that is continuously developed by the LoRa Alliance®. Utilizing a unique modulation technique (Chirp Spread Spectrum), LoRaWAN® achieves exceptional range and superior building penetration capabilities.
With its bidirectional communication, robust security through advanced encryption technologies, and low energy consumption, LoRaWAN® is an ideal solution for the remote reading of water meters.
